  • Patent number: 12331281
    Abstract: This present disclosure relates to a designed material surface mimicking properties of an extracellular matrix or matrisome, as a means for modulating cell adhesion, spreading, proliferation, differentiation, or reprogramming; and for controllable, directional cell adhesion, spreading, proliferation, differentiation, or reprogramming. In particular, this present disclosure relates to a designed material surface mimicking properties of large polysaccharides for modulating cell adhesion, proliferation, differentiation, or reprogramming of a cell, and to materials for scaffolding cell growth. Processes and composition matters are within the scope of this patent application.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: September 3, 2021
    Date of Patent: June 17, 2025
    Assignee: Purdue Research Foundation
    Inventors: Shelley A. Claridge, Tyson C. Davis, Sarah Calve, Alita Miller, Anamika Singh
